> At the moment, *_VIRT_END may either point to the address after the end
> or the last address of the region.
> 
> The lack of consistency make quite difficult to reason with them.
> 
> Furthermore, there is a risk of overflow in the case where the address
> points past to the end. I am not aware of any cases, so this is only a
> latent bug.
> 
> Start to solve the problem by removing all the *_VIRT_END exclusively used
> by the Arm code and add *_VIRT_SIZE when it is not present.
> 
> Take the opportunity to rename BOOT_FDT_SLOT_SIZE to BOOT_FDT_VIRT_SIZE
> for better consistency and use _AT(vaddr_t, ).

> I noticed that a few functions in Xen expect [start, end[. This is risky
> as we may end up with end < start if the region is defined right at the
> top of the address space.
> 
> I haven't yet tackle this issue. But I would at least like to get rid
> of *_VIRT_END.
